What is the role of mental health first-aid training in university education in the United States?
Mental health first-aid training has become increasingly important in university education in the United States in recent years. The training equips individuals with the skills and knowledge necessary to identify, understand, and respond to mental health challenges that their peers may be facing. This is particularly important in a university setting, where stress levels can be high, and mental health challenges can often go unnoticed.
The role of mental health first-aid training in university education is twofold. First, it helps to reduce the stigma surrounding mental health challenges by promoting a culture of openness and understanding. Second, it provides students and staff with the tools they need to support their peers in times of need.
During the training, participants learn how to recognize common mental health challenges such as depression, anxiety, and substance abuse disorders. They also learn how to provide initial help and support, and when and where to refer someone for professional help. The training is typically delivered in a workshop format and can be completed in a day or over several sessions.
Mental health first-aid training is not a substitute for professional mental health care. However, it can play an important role in creating a supportive and inclusive campus environment, and in helping individuals access the care they need.
